  1. Small update on Papercuts - the label already delivered the hi-res versions for all tracks and reveal the quality for all those:

     

    Numb/Encore - 24-bit/96.0kHz

    QWERTY - 24-bit/96.0kHz

    New Divide - 24-bit/96.0kHz

     

    Just a reminder that all 3 will be available in hi-res quality for the first time.

  7. On reddit there are many question about what version of Qwerty will be here on Papercuts, you can point the link to this post on reddit to anyone who have that question. I already confirmed that there will be no any changes on Qwerty but, since there are two versions of it I will just point out which version will be on Papercuts and the answer is the 2008 version. We can called it like that because there was only one release with it which came in 2008 which was "Songs From The underground" CD released worlwide outside the LPU fanclub. Here are the differences between the LPU 6.0 version and 2008 version:

     

    LPU 6.0

     

    - the length is 3:21

    - at the beginning it contains transition from 'Announcement Service Public'

     

    2008 version

     

    - length is 3:23

    - no transition from 'Announcement Service Public'

    - plus one and half seconds of silence at the end
